Well, guess what, y’all? He’s in on the joke.

Michael Bolton understands that his heavy-handed love ballads of the 1990s have drifted into the campy territory over the years, and he has a sense of humor about it. He’s gone full-blown, self-deprecating comedy in his new Netflix Valentine’s special, teaming up with the kings of spoofs: The Lonely Island, Andy Samberg, and Fred Armisen.

The special will have his old hits interspersed with gag songs such as “Jack Sparrow”– a slow jam complete with interpretive dancing pirates.
